The catalogs below are used to store selectable options for assets and features throughout VertiGIS FM. You can add options to these catalogs or edit existing ones by clicking Administration > Master Data > Catalog Management > Platform.

This section stores the options that users can select from ownership drop-down menus to indicate the commercial status of an asset or object (for example, Leased, Property, Rented, Third-party property). The Leased entry in this section is hard-coded and cannot be deleted. This option is associated with additional functionality in some VertiGIS FM modules. For example, if you select Leased from the Ownership menu in a vehicle's details, the form loads an additional Leasing section in which you can specify the details of the vehicle's lease. |
